NVIDIA® GB10 GraceBlackwell Superchip
Get up to 1000 TOPS of AI compute at FP4 precision with an NVIDIA®Blackwell GPU. Supercharge data preprocessing and orchestration with aGrace 20-core Arm CPU.[3]
Unified systemmemory
Run AI development and testing workloads with AI models of up to 200billion parameters at your desk with 128 GB of coherent unified systemmemory.
NVIDIA® ConnectX™ Networking
Work with even larger AI models locally—up to 405 billion parameters—by connecting two HP ZGX Nano systems together to scale localcompute resources.[4]
Tiny AI powerhouse
Measuring at 150mm L x 150mm W x 51mm H,5 this new class ofdesktop is purpose-built for AI development yet fits in the palm of yourhand.[5]
